From what I've seen, a lot of characters from older generations have come to return for Sun and Moon. What's the full list of all of them though? I'm curious.

There are Colress, Looker, Anabel, Grimsley, Red, and Blue that I know. For some reason I seem to remember Wally being there too, bu that might be just confusion on my part.
Wally and Cynthia are also there.
And Sina and Dexio.
  • Anabel, a Frontier Brain from Emerald.
  • Red and Blue, the original rivals.
  • Sina and Dexio, who were totally not those masked heroes from XY.
  • Cynthia, Champion of Sinnoh.
  • Wally, that lucky child who caught a Ralts on his first try.
  • Colress, the scientist with weird morals.
  • Grimsley, the coolest of the Unova Elite Four
  • Looker reappears to hunt down the Ultra Beasts
  • While not really a returning character, Whitney is mentioned when you order a Moomoo Milk from a café.
  • Professor Burnet, the Professor from Gen V's Pokémon Dream Radar.

If I missed any, please let me know!

I also heard Kukui's wife, Burnet, is also a returning character. From a spin-off game, apparently.
Oh yes, Professor Burnet from Dream Radar! I'll add that.